Honeywell Automation India Limited specializes in automation and control systems, delivering distributed and building control systems alongside smart transmitters. The company, established as a joint venture with Tata Group, evolved into a subsidiary of Honeywell International, marking significant international backing. Honeywell operates state-of-the-art manufacturing and engineering facilities in Pune, emphasizing modernization and scale of operations. A strategic shift towards energy solutions is evident with their first Battery Energy Storage System commissioned in Lakshadweep. Consistently striving for quality and innovation, Honeywell achieved multiple ISO certifications, showcasing commitment to high standards and customer service.

Net profit rose 21.1% year-on-year to ₹1,507 million for the quarter ended June 30, 2026.
The company reported a standalone net profit of ₹150.7 crore for the quarter ended June 30, 2026 (Q1 FY27).
The stock rose sharply after the company reported a margin-led profitability beat in Q4 FY26 and recommended a ₹110 per share final dividend.
Revenue from operations in Q4 FY25 was ₹1,114.50 crore, up about 17% year-on-year from ₹951.00 crore.
